Give Us SpaceThere’s always room for more feminist thoughtBy Carlos Suarez De JesusPublished on September 14, 2006Don’t expect tidy scenes of domestic order in this exhibit by four Cuban-American women artists. “A Room of One’s Own” features the work of Teresita Fernández, Maria Elena González, Quisqueya HenrĂquez, and MarĂa MartĂnez-Cañas and examines how architecture and the physicality of space shape our daily realities and our perception of the world. “By taking elements that are recognizable to us -- a house, plant life, a volcano, and the sounds of daily urban environments -- the artists prompt viewers to re-examine how we perceive these things and what they represent,” curator Elizabeth Cerejido explains.
